How can people access legal services or legal advice related to their judicial record in Mexico?

People who need legal services or legal advice related to their judicial record in Mexico can consult with an attorney or public defender. They can also look for non-governmental organizations or civil rights associations that provide free or low-cost legal assistance to people with criminal records. It is important to obtain legal advice to understand your rights and options.

How is possession regulated in cases of parents who have failed to comply with child support obligations in Argentina?

Custody in cases of parents who have failed to comply with maintenance obligations in Argentina is addressed considering the best interests of the child. The court may take into account non-compliance with maintenance obligations as a relevant factor when deciding on custody and visitation. The aim is to guarantee the well-being and economic stability of the child.
